Loom's core is deterministic — no AI required. It prevents wasting AI.

It scans your repo, infers architecture and conventions, and compiles compact context that any agent (Claude, Codex, Cursor) can consume — so they stop re-reading 700 files and start working with the right 7.

> AI can optionally enhance selection (future), but the foundation is always deterministic and reproducible.

```
Without Loom:  35KB prompt  →  agent reads everything  →  drift, waste, hallucinations
With Loom:     2.6KB bundle →  agent reads what matters →  precision, consistency, savings
```

No cloud. No LLM. No heavy deps. Deterministic analysis in <2 seconds. 93% fewer tokens.

## 🎯 15 Commands

### 🔍 Scan & Generate

```bash
loom init .                    # Full scan + .context/ + .loom/ + audit
loom scan .                    # Re-scan and update .context/
```

### 📝 Context for AI

```bash
loom prompt . --stdout         # Full master prompt (all context)
loom focus "auth" . --stdout   # Filtered prompt by topic
loom bundle "task" . --stdout  # Task-specific bundle with manifest
loom handoff "task" . --save   # Session continuity summary
loom export . --agent claude   # Format for specific agent
```

### ✅ Quality & Audit

```bash
loom audit .                   # Validate naming + boundary rules
loom enrich .                  # Re-audit + refresh + persist findings
loom doctor .                  # Health check (11 diagnostics)
```

### 📊 State & Memory

```bash
loom status .                  # Project health dashboard
loom decide "..." -r "..." -s architecture  # Record decision
loom log "note" -p .           # Session memory
loom plan .                    # Summarize docs/plans
loom watch . --interval 60     # Continuous re-scan
```

## 📁 What Loom Generates

```
.context/                      ← canonical, reproducible, shareable
  index.json                   ← entry point + quick_rules
  architecture.md              ← patterns + layer boundaries
  naming.md                    ← conventions + suffix/prefix patterns
  directory-map.md             ← annotated directory tree
  stack.json                   ← categorized dependencies
  rules.json                   ← machine-readable rules for audit
  plans-summary.md             ← docs and plan progress
  exports/                     ← agent-specific formats
  bundles/                     ← task-specific context + manifests

.loom/                         ← live state, local per user
  inconsistencies.json         ← last audit findings
  decisions.jsonl              ← architectural decision records
  sessions.jsonl               ← session log with git metadata
  mutations.jsonl              ← context change history
```

## 🔍 What It Detects

| Area | Detection |
|------|-----------|
| 🏗️ Architecture | Clean Architecture, Hexagonal, MVC, MVVM, Pipeline, Feature-based, Layered |
| 📦 Project Type | React Native/Expo, Next.js, Angular, Vue, Python, Rust, Go, Java, and more |
| 🏷️ Naming | PascalCase, camelCase, kebab-case, snake_case, I-prefix, use-prefix, suffixes |
| 📦 Stack | 130+ known packages categorized (ui, state, db, testing, DI, etc.) |
| 📄 Docs | Markdown with frontmatter, plan status, section headings |
| ⚙️ Rules | Layer boundaries, naming conventions, import aliases |

---

## 🔒 Security

Three layers of filtering — your source code never appears in output:

1. ✅ Respects `.gitignore`
2. ✅ Respects `.contextignore`
3. ✅ Always excludes `.env`, `*.pem`, `*.key`, credentials

Output is metadata only: file names, patterns, rules, structure. Never source code.

## 📊 Real-World Results

Tested on a 674-file React Native project:

| Metric | Result |
|--------|--------|
| Scan time | 0.9s |
| Files analyzed | 674 files, 95 dependencies, 59 docs |
| Architecture detected | Clean Architecture + Hexagonal + Feature-based |
| Naming patterns | 67 Repositories, 28 Mappers, 17 Services, 14 ViewModels |
| Boundary violations | 107 (all in `core/` importing from `infrastructure/`) |
| Bundle vs prompt | 2.6KB vs 35KB (93% reduction) |
| Export formats | Claude, Cursor, Codex, Generic |
